What it's actually like to stay here

Checking into Wang Gaew Resort feels straightforward and welcoming, with a Thai-run vibe that emphasizes simplicity over formality—expect efficient front desk handling without much fanfare. Rooms are comfortable with basic furnishings suited for beach stays, offering clean spaces that prioritize functionality for families or couples unwinding after a day by the sea. The standout amenity is the direct beach access right on Laem Mae Phim Bay, allowing guests to step straight onto the sand for a less crowded alternative to Koh Samet's beaches, with similar soft sands and calm waters. The swimming pool provides a refreshing spot, especially for kids, though it's not oversized. Food at the on-site restaurant shines with fresh seafood caught locally, served in casual Thai style—think grilled fish and spicy salads that appeal to those wanting authentic flavors without venturing far. Service is friendly and attentive in a familial way, typical of Thai hospitality, but it might not match the polished efficiency of global chains. Guests here are mostly Thai families on weekend getaways or couples seeking a peaceful coastal break, creating a relaxed, community-oriented atmosphere mid-week that picks up energy on weekends. Overall, it's a solid mid-range pick for value-driven beach time, delivering quiet comfort without extravagance.

Location reality check

Wang Gaew Resort sits directly on Laem Mae Phim beach in Rayong's eastern coast, with zero walking minutes to the sand and sea. The area is quieter than nearby Koh Samet, reachable by a 30-45 minute ferry from Ban Phe pier, about a 20-minute drive away. Within a 5-minute walk, you'll find the beachfront and basic local eateries, but for Rayong city shopping or attractions like the Rayong Aquarium, plan a 30-40 minute drive or Grab ride costing around 400-600 THB.
